Aria on the Bay tops Miami-Dade weekly condo sales 

Top 10 sales ranged from $1.5M to $7.5M

Miami-Dade County Weekly Condo Report
488 North East 18th Street (Google Maps, Getty)

Miami-Dade County’s condo sales ticked higher during the last full week of January, while the average sale price and price per square foot kept sliding.

Brokers closed 97 condo sales totaling $74.1 million from Jan. 21st to Jan. 27th. The previous week, brokers closed 81 condo sales totaling $70.6 million.

Last week’s units sold for an average of $764,239, lower than the $871,473 average sale price from the previous week. The average price per square foot fell just a dollar, to $542 from $543, according to data from condo.com. Condos closed after an average of 69 days on the market.

For the top 10 sales, prices ranged from $1.5 million to $7.5 million. Two sales broke the $5 million price barrier.

Aria on the Bay unit PH 15, at 488 Northeast 15th Street in Miami, took the top spot with a $7.5 million closing. Farrah Zarghami with Parsiani Real Estate had the listing. Heather McCabe with Beachfront Realty represented the buyer. The sale closed after 300 days on the market at $1,564 per square foot.

Monad Terrace in Miami Beach, unit 2F at 1300 Monad Terrace, closed for the second highest amount, $6.5 million, or $2,445 per square foot, after 94 days on the market. Jill Hertzberg with Coldwell Banker Realty had the listing. Bryan Harr with One Sotheby’s International Realty represented the buyer.
